摘要: 阐述了城市绿色廊道系统在城市绿地系统中的应用及生态价值,并在分析东营市西城区绿地系统现状的基础上,提出了建设西城区绿地廊道系统的方法,以加强城市孤立绿地斑块之间以及城市绿地与城郊外围自然环境的联系,优化城市绿地系统的结构,提高城市生态系统的稳定性.通过合理构建绿色廊道网络系统,西城区将新增绿地面积1400hm2,人均绿地面积将达到66m2,城市与郊区的绿地生态系统将贯通为一体,绿地生态系统的服务范围将扩展到整个城区,为提高西城区居民的生活质量,增强西城区生态敏感区的生态稳定性提供有力支持.

Abstract: This paper discussed the ecological significance of urban green corridors network in urban green space ecosystem, analyzed the present status of green space ecosystem in the west urban area of Dongying in Shangdong Province, and figured out the ways of constructing urban green corridors network in this area to strengthen the linkage between its fragmented greenbelts, and between these greenbelts and rural natural environment. Through the construction of this network, the greenbelt area in the west urban area of Dongying would increase 1400 hm2, greenbelt area per capita would increase to 66 m2, and urban and rural greenbelts would be integrated into a whole system to serve the whole city, giving a powerful support to enhance the life quality of local people and the stability of urban ecosystem.
